#06a254 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#06a254 is composed of 2.4% red, 63.5%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 48.1%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 150 degrees, a saturation of 92.9% and a lightness of 32.9%. #06a254 color hex could be obtained by blending #0cffa8 with #004500.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

Shades and Tints of #06a254

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000b06 is the darkest color, while #f7fff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#06a254

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#545454 is the less saturated color, while #06a254 is the most saturated one.
